In any modern supply chain, the true power of KPIs emerges when they bridge silos rather than reward isolated performance. When leadership designs indicators that span distribution, manufacturing, procurement, and customer service, every team experiences a shared purpose. This approach minimizes conflicting priorities and encourages collaborative problem solving. Start by mapping the core value stream and identifying the few measures that most strongly influence customer experience and cost to serve. Focus on leading indicators that predict outcomes, and tie lag results to actionable steps teams can take within their domains. The result is a pragmatic framework that drives alignment without stifling local expertise.
Effective cross-functional KPIs require clear ownership and consistent definitions. Ambiguity breeds misalignment, so governance should specify who collects data, how often it is refreshed, and what constitutes acceptable variance. Establish a regular cadenced review that includes representatives from each function, ensuring every voice is heard when decisions are made. Metrics should be simple, intuitive, and visual enough to inform day-to-day actions. Avoid overloading dashboards with noise—prioritize a concise set of metrics that reflect both efficiency and resilience. When teams understand not only what to measure but why it matters, accountability follows naturally.
Build a concise KPI pyramid that links actions to outcomes.
A well-designed KPI set begins with a clear macro objective and then cascades into domain-specific measures. In distribution, for instance, on-time delivery and route optimization directly impact customer satisfaction and transport spend. Manufacturing watches cycle time, yield, and changeover efficiency because these factors determine throughput and capacity readiness. Procurement focuses on supplier lead times, defect rates, and total landed cost, which influence pricing and inventory. Customer service monitors first-contact resolution and escalation rates to gauge the effectiveness of support. Each metric ties back to the overarching goal: delivering the right product, at the right time, with minimal friction and cost.

The process of cascading KPIs should also embed continuous learning. Teams need feedback loops that indicate when performance deviates from targets and why. Root-cause analysis sessions become routine rather than episodic exercises. Encourage a culture of experimentation where small, safe changes are tested, observed, and either scaled or abandoned. Transparent data sharing across functions fosters trust and reduces finger-pointing. In practice, this means standardized data definitions, synchronized planning calendars, and shared dashboards that present both performance results and the underlying drivers. When teams see how their efforts connect to others, collaboration becomes automatic.

A practical KPI pyramid starts with strategic outcomes at the top and works down to operational measures. At the apex sits the customer experience metric that captures perceived value and loyalty. The next layer translates that into reliability measures for delivery, quality, and responsiveness. The bottom layer comprises efficiency indicators like inventory turns, capacity utilization, and supplier fill rate. Each level should have a clear line of sight to the previous one, so an improvement in a lower-level metric propagates upward. For example, reducing batch size in production may improve throughput and shorten lead times, which then improves on-time delivery and customer satisfaction. This cascading logic makes objectives tangible.

To keep the pyramid practical, set guardrails that prevent metric creep. Limit the number of metrics at each level to what truly matters, and remove vanity indicators that do not influence decision-making. Establish explicit targets derived from historical data, benchmarking, and strategic ambitions. Make targets time-bound to create urgency and momentum. Integrate ratio metrics where appropriate to normalize performance across seasons and volumes. Finally, ensure data quality is non-negotiable; dashboards should reflect accurate, timely information, not tortured interpretations. With disciplined design, KPIs stop being passive reports and become active instruments for improvement.

Dashboards should illuminate the causal links between actions and outcomes across functions. For instance, procurement decisions about supplier diversity may affect inventory availability, which in turn influences production schedules and customer lead times. Visualizations that connect procurement lead time to manufacturing throughput help teams see where delays originate and how they ripple through the system. Color-coded alerts can flag when a link in the chain threatens service levels, prompting proactive interventions. A well-crafted dashboard also records trends, enabling teams to recognize patterns and anticipate shifts rather than merely reacting to events. The goal is situational awareness that drives coordinated response.
Beyond visibility, dashboards must empower action. Include recommended next steps, owners, and due dates for each metric showing off-target performance. Integrate scenario planning so teams can simulate the impact of decisions, such as changing supplier mix or adjusting safety stock levels. Encourage cross-functional commentary within the dashboard, so stakeholders can document hypotheses and outcomes from experiments. Regular training ensures that staff interpret the data consistently and apply it to daily routines. When dashboards become living playbooks, alignment matures from aspiration to execution.

KPIs influence behavior when linked to meaningful incentives and recognized performance. Design compensation and recognition systems that reward collaboration as well as individual excellence. For example, teams might earn shared bonuses when cross-functional targets are met, reinforcing cooperation rather than rivalry. Non-financial rewards, such as public recognition, professional development opportunities, and visibility into impact, can also strengthen alignment. Avoid perverse incentives that encourage gaming the system or sacrificing long-term value for short-term gains. A transparent framework that explains how metrics influence compensation builds trust and sustains disciplined focus.
Behavioral norms matter as much as numerical targets. Establish expectations around communication, data sharing, and problem ownership. Create rituals that reinforce alignment, such as joint planning sessions, weekly cross-functional check-ins, and post-mortems after deviations. Documented standard operating procedures ensure consistent how-to actions, while leadership modeling demonstrates that decisions are made with a holistic view. Over time, teams internalize a culture where seeking mutual gains becomes the default. The resulting environment supports steady progress, even as individual function priorities evolve with market conditions.
In designing cross-functional KPIs, risk and resilience must be embedded into the core framework. Identify the most consequential disruptions—supply shocks, demand volatility, or capacity constraints—and reflect their likelihood and impact in the KPI design. Scenario-based targets help teams anticipate adverse events and maintain service levels. Build redundancy where it creates value, but avoid excessive safety stock that erodes cash flow. Encourage resilience metrics such as operational uptime, recovery time after disruptions, and the speed of corrective actions. Regularly review risk-adjusted performance to ensure the KPI set remains robust under changing conditions and adaptable to new threats and opportunities.
Finally, sustain momentum through disciplined, iterative refinement. KPIs should be living instruments that evolve with business strategy and market dynamics. Schedule periodic redesigns to remove metrics that no longer drive value and to incorporate emerging priorities. Solicit cross-functional feedback to ensure relevance and fairness, and publish clear roadmaps showing planned enhancements. By maintaining a balance between stability and adaptability, organizations preserve alignment across distribution, manufacturing, procurement, and customer service teams. The ongoing practice of refining KPIs becomes a competitive advantage, enabling coordinated action that preserves service quality while controlling cost.
